Key Specs at a Glance
- Parallelism: 0.005mm/100mm.
- Squareness: 0.005mm.
- Construction: high-quality steel.
- Movable jaw section: Configurable.
- Orientation capability: upright and flat.
- Additional specs: Available upon request.

Models & Dimensions
All dimensions in mm. Weight in kg.
| Order No. | L | B | H | Weight |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| ZQ8400-I | 140 | 105 | 65 | 3.5 |
| ZQ8401-I | 160 | 125 | 65 | 4.2 |

How to Pick the Right Model (Fast)
- Jaw width (B) — match with your workpiece dimensions.
- Max opening (Smax) — ensure full opening suits your project size.
- Overall length (L) & weight — verify it fits your machine’s capacity.
